Output 52ff4e6abd2bfca680b668eca4f452f61d732adea41fa70976847ead8cb59b82:1

value
979234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2ac151bac4079ae0118a42bfd249cad0cc0bd2 OP_EQUAL
address
3LDGKAYsSso4bgZVAY6eKhhFKx2ZJdoWLr
transaction
52ff4e6abd2bfca680b668eca4f452f61d732adea41fa70976847ead8cb59b82
spent
true